Most homeowner insurance policies cover sudden, accidental water damage. What separates a clean claim from a stuck one is fast professional response with documentation an adjuster can actually use.
The cold climate of Upper Kalskag can cause pipes to freeze and burst, leading to unexpected sewage backups. Additionally, thawing permafrost during spring can damage underground plumbing, increasing the likelihood of water and sewage intrusion.
